International Employer of Record Solutions for Global Businesses

In today's increasingly globalized world, businesses are constantly seeking new opportunities for growth. Expanding into international territories can be a lucrative strategy, but it also presents unique obstacles. Navigating foreign labor laws, setting up local operations, and ensuring compliance with diverse regulations can be a daunting task. This is where International Employer of Record (EOR) solutions become invaluable assets for global businesses.

An EOR acts as a legal sponsor for your employees in foreign countries. By partnering with an EOR, you can utilize their expertise to handle the complexities of international payroll, benefits administration, tax compliance, and other HR functions. This allows your business to focus on its core competencies while ensuring a smooth and compliant venture into new markets.

  • Ultimately, an EOR can simplify the international hiring process, reducing administrative burdens and reducing legal risks for your company.
